What is hex #7C6976 Color?

Old Lavender (Hex code: 7C6976) Thumbnail

The color name of hex code #7C6976 is Old Lavender. The RGB values are (124, 105, 118) which means it is composed of 36% red, 30% green and 34% blue. The CMYK color codes, used in printers, are C:0 M:15 Y:5 K:51. In the HSV/HSB scale, #7C6976 has a hue of 319°, 15% saturation and a brightness value of 49%.

The complement of #7C6976 is #697C6F which is called Nickel. Complementary colors are those found at the opposite ends of the color wheel. Thus, as per the RGB system, the best contrast to #7C6976 color is offered by #697C6F. The complementary color palette is easiest to use and work with. As per the RGB color wheel, the split-complementary colors of #7C6976 are #6D7C69 (Nickel) and #697C79 (AuroMetalSaurus). A split-complementary color palette consists of the main color along with those on either side (30°) of the complementary color. Based on our research, usage of split-complementary palettes is on the rise online, especially in graphics and web sites designs. It may be because it is not as contrasting as the complementary color palette and, hence, results in a combination which is pleasant to the eyes.
